Mold Removal Overview
Finding dark spots spreading across drywall or catching a musty smell in the basement puts most homeowners on edge. Professional mold removal replaces that uncertainty with a documented plan - inspection, containment, remediation, and verification - carried out by trained technicians who know how mold behaves in Wisconsin structures.
Mold removal in Fond du Lac County covers far more than scrubbing a surface. Certified crews trace the moisture source, isolate affected areas, remove contaminated materials, and treat what remains so growth does not return.
- Certified inspection - moisture mapping, thermal imaging, and air or surface sampling where warranted
- Containment - plastic barriers and negative air pressure that keep spores from traveling into clean rooms
- HEPA filtration - air scrubbers running throughout the work to capture airborne particles
- Material removal - controlled demolition of porous items such as drywall, carpet padding, and insulation that cannot be salvaged
- Antimicrobial treatment - application to framing, subfloor, and remaining structural surfaces
- Moisture correction - drying and repair of the leak, seepage, or humidity problem that started it
- Rebuild support - drywall, trim, paint, and flooring restored after clearance

Common Mold Removal Issues in Fond du Lac County, Wisconsin
Sitting at the southern tip of Lake Winnebago, Fond du Lac County combines high seasonal humidity, heavy snowmelt, and a housing stock that spans well over a century. That mix creates predictable mold patterns.
Local Conditions That Feed Mold Growth
- Lake-influenced humidity - summer dew points near Winnebago keep indoor relative humidity elevated without dehumidification
- Spring thaw saturation - clay-heavy soils shed meltwater toward foundations rather than absorbing it
- Ice dams - trapped meltwater backs under shingles and soaks attic sheathing and ceiling cavities
- Stone and block basements - older foundations in the city of Fond du Lac and rural townships wick groundwater through mortar joints
- Sump pump failures - a single outage during a heavy rain event can saturate finished lower levels
- Tight winter envelopes - sealed homes trap cooking, bathing, and laundry moisture on cold exterior walls
Warning Signs Worth Acting On
- Persistent earthy or musty odor, strongest near floor level or in closets
- Staining or discoloration on drywall seams, baseboards, and ceiling corners
- Peeling paint, bubbling wallpaper, or cupped hardwood planks
- Condensation on windows and cold water lines during winter months
- Allergy-type symptoms that ease when residents leave the house
- Soft or crumbling drywall behind furniture placed against exterior walls
Small patches on a shower curtain or windowsill can often be wiped away with a household cleaner and the moisture source corrected. Growth spreading beyond roughly 10 square feet calls for the three-phase approach described in public guidance on cleaning options - and generally warrants a certified remediation contractor.

Mold Removal Seasonal Patterns in Fond du Lac County
Mold calls follow the Wisconsin calendar closely, with each season producing its own trigger.
- Late winter (February - March) - Ice dams push meltwater into attics and ceiling cavities. Interior condensation peaks on windows and uninsulated exterior walls.
- Spring (April - May) - Frozen ground plus snowmelt and rain drives water against foundations. Basement seepage and sump overload dominate calls.
- Summer (June - August) - Lake-driven humidity keeps basements damp. Air conditioning creates cold surfaces where condensation forms behind furniture and in crawl spaces.
- Early fall (September - October) - Homeowners closing up cottages and lake properties discover growth that developed unnoticed over the humid months.
- Late fall and early winter (November - January) - Sealed houses trap indoor moisture. Attic frost forms, then melts during thaws and soaks insulation.
Two habits reduce year-round risk: running a dehumidifier in the lower level from spring through early fall, and inspecting attics, crawl spaces, and behind stored boxes at each season change. Catching a small area early usually means a limited cleanup instead of extensive material removal.
Housing Characteristics & Mold Removal Considerations
Fond du Lac County housing runs from pre-1900 farmhouses and Victorian-era homes in the city to mid-century ranches, lake cottages, and recent subdivision construction. Each type shapes how remediation is planned.
Older Homes and Farmhouses
- Fieldstone or unsealed block foundations that allow steady moisture transfer
- Balloon framing that lets spores and air travel between floors through open wall cavities
- Plaster and lath that hides growth until staining reaches the surface
- Minimal original insulation, creating cold spots where condensation collects
- Layered renovations - vinyl over hardwood over subfloor - that trap moisture between materials
Mid-Century and Ranch Homes
- Finished basements with wood paneling or carpet installed directly against block walls
- Crawl spaces with exposed dirt floors and no vapor barrier
- Original bathroom fans vented into attics rather than outdoors
Newer and Lake-Area Construction
- Tight building envelopes that hold humidity when mechanical ventilation is undersized
- Seasonal cottages left unheated and unmonitored for months
- Walkout lower levels in Kettle Moraine terrain where grading directs runoff toward the slab
Remediation teams adjust containment size, demolition scope, and drying equipment to the structure. A century home may require careful plaster removal and framing treatment, while a newer build may need targeted drywall cuts plus ventilation upgrades. Homes built before 1978 also warrant lead-safe practices during any material removal.
Environmental Conditions & Mold Removal Implications
The county's climate and geology work together to keep building materials damp longer than in drier regions.
Climate Factors
- Four distinct seasons with wide temperature swings that drive condensation cycles
- Summer dew points elevated by proximity to Lake Winnebago
- Substantial annual snowfall producing concentrated spring melt
- Freeze-thaw cycling that opens cracks in foundations, mortar, and exterior masonry
- Spring and summer thunderstorms delivering heavy rainfall in short bursts
Soil and Water Conditions
- Clay-rich soils across much of the county drain slowly and hold water against foundation walls
- Kettle Moraine gravel and till in eastern townships create irregular subsurface drainage paths
- Shallow groundwater near the lake basin and along the Fond du Lac River corridor
- Karst and fractured bedrock features in parts of the county allowing rapid water movement
- Flat lakeshore terrain that limits natural runoff away from structures
These conditions mean remediation must address water intrusion, not just visible growth. Crews commonly recommend regrading soil away from the foundation, extending downspouts several feet from the house, sealing foundation cracks, adding or upgrading sump systems with battery backup, and installing vapor barriers in crawl spaces. Indoor humidity held between roughly 30 and 50 percent gives mold far less opportunity to establish. Basement and Lower-Level Mold in Lake Winnebago Country
Basements generate more mold calls in Fond du Lac County than any other part of the house. The reasons are structural, geological, and seasonal all at once - and understanding them helps homeowners decide when a wipe-down is enough and when certified remediation is the right call.
Why Lower Levels Are Vulnerable Here
- Below-grade walls stay cool year-round, so warm humid air condenses on them every summer
- Clay soil holds meltwater and rainfall against foundations for days after a storm
- Older block and stone walls transfer moisture by capillary action even without a visible leak
- Finished lower levels place carpet, padding, paneling, and stored cardboard directly in the damp zone
- Limited airflow behind furniture and shelving creates stagnant pockets ideal for growth
How a Basement Remediation Typically Proceeds
- Assessment - technicians measure moisture in walls, framing, and flooring and identify the water source
- Containment setup - the affected zone is sealed off with barriers and placed under negative air pressure
- Controlled removal - saturated carpet, padding, paneling, insulation, and drywall are cut back beyond the visible growth line
- Cleaning and treatment - HEPA vacuuming, damp wiping, and antimicrobial application on framing and masonry
- Structural drying - dehumidifiers and air movers bring materials back to acceptable moisture readings
- Verification - post-remediation inspection and, where appropriate, clearance testing
- Restoration - rebuild of walls, flooring, and finishes once the space is dry and clear
Keeping It From Returning
- Run a properly sized dehumidifier from spring through early fall
- Store belongings in sealed plastic bins on shelving, never cardboard on the floor
- Test the sump pump before spring melt and add battery backup
- Leave a few inches of air gap behind furniture placed along foundation walls
- Vent bathroom and laundry exhaust fully to the exterior
